About this ebook
Making your sites responsive is an easy enough skill to learn, and really pays dividends when you're selling your product to potential clients or just trying to impress your boss for that promotion you want, but understanding all your options will help you develop a workflow that really works for you.
Instant Responsive Web Design makes learning mobile-friendly web design a piece of cake with site-builds imploring various approaches using a very easy-to-follow format where you'll actually be creating sites using each approach. Expand your web repertoire in a few, easy hours.
Instant Responsive Web Design takes the guesswork out of responsive web design, by teaching readers the most relevant approaches and leaves it up to them to develop a workflow that works best for their style of coding.
We'll help you to develop several websites from scratch using different philosophies such as the Goldilocks Approach, make your websites Fluid, understand desktop and mobile-first approaches, and master some of the tricky stuff such as making your images and video responsive.
In this step-by-step guide, you'll learn everything you could ever need to become an above-average responsive web designer in a matter of hours.
ApproachGet to grips with a new technology, understand what it is and what it can do for you, and then get to work with the most important features and tasks. A step-by-step tutorial approach which will teach the readers what responsive web design is and how it is used in designing a responsive web page.
Who this book is forIf you are a web-designer looking to expand your skill set by learning the quickly growing industry standard of responsive web design, this book is ideal for you. Knowledge of CSS is assumed.

About the Author
Cory Simmons is a web designer/developer with over 17 years of experience. He currently works at Pressed Web, where he has maintained a tutorial blog for years covering everything from basic HTML/CSS to Django and Meteor. He has worked for companies such as Scholastic and World Vision Charities. Cory has written for CSS Tricks and is an author at TutsPlus. He created and maintains the Jeet Framework.
